Altona, VIC Australia is a vibrant suburb located just 13 kilometers southwest of Melbourne's central business district. It is home to a diverse community, offering a mix of residential, commercial, and industrial spaces. With its proximity to the coast, Altona boasts beautiful beaches, parks, and a thriving local art scene. The suburb is well-connected with excellent transport links, making it an attractive location for businesses and professionals alike.
